Splitomicin
Splitomicin is a cell-permeable lactone derived from naphthol and known to be a potent selective inhibitor of Sir2 (silent information regulator 2) and HDAC. Splitomicin inhibits the NAD+-dependent deacetylase activity of Sir2 in vitro. It increases the levels of cyclic AMP by inhibiting the activity of cyclic AMP phosphodiesterase, interferes with mobilization of intracellular Ca+2 and ATP release.
